China Guangdong Shenzhen Alibaba Cloud
Websites on 39.108.177.3
- Domain names that have been bound:
- 2023-08-26-----2024-08-28qianmengdao.com
- 2019-12-03-----2024-07-20mmfjd.cn
- 2023-07-21-----2024-03-17mmqmd.com
- 2019-11-20-----2024-01-08www.mmfjd.cn
- 2020-04-08-----2023-11-21chickenisland.com
- 2023-10-24-----2023-10-24mmqmd.cn
- website server lookup history
- www.honli168.com
- dp3ty4tla2k5r.com
- xlstyy.com
- 34939.com
- www.guanren15.com
- ph93.cc
- 4portun.com
- www.kok205.com
- 238755.com
- m.cddmj88.com
- haiouyoulun.com
- 199454.com
- 9969.net
- mysouthborough.com
- ttr3e.jantourist.com
- www.4nfsb3i.com
- incestxxxcartoons.com
- www.9516.cc
- guogan.zuq009.com
- www.42198c.com
- hosting ip address lookup history
- 192.151.225.202
- 101.36.191.248
- 34.226.65.85
- 116.19.151.134
- 149.126.6.174
- 52.54.14.192
- 208.113.162.59
- 180.215.154.126
- 121.9.243.168
- 156.234.240.145
- 113.204.82.44
- 108.160.170.43
- 212.60.50.4
- 111.229.194.246
- 47.75.247.112
- 211.149.155.113
- 172.67.204.159
- 103.254.72.170
- 42.81.86.100
- 124.223.205.104
